Abstract:

An algorithm-independent description model was established for the ism, and both efficiency-related and efficiency-independent parameters were identified. Besides,the impact of system scale on efficiency was investigated, and an important observation was obtained that the product of the two utilization ratios (i.e., the utilization ratio of disk space and that of I/O bandwidth) is approximately inversely proportional to the number of nodes contained in the system. The observation was verified through experimental resu reason behind was revealed through theoretical analy-sis. The study provides guidelines for the application of replication-based storage mechanism in engineering, and lays a theoretical foundation for the trade-off between the two utilization ratios and for the prediction of I/O performance in large-scale storage systems.
